The Science of COVID-19:
The science
of COVID-19 begins with understanding the origins of the virus. SARS-CoV-2, the
coronavirus responsible for COVID-19, is believed to have originated in bats
and, potentially, passed through an intermediate animal host before reaching
humans. The exact animal intermediary remains a subject of ongoing research and
investigation. Understanding these origins is essential for preventing future
pandemics and zoonotic spillovers.
The
transmission of SARS-CoV-2 primarily occurs through respiratory droplets when
an infected person coughs, sneezes, or talks. It can also spread via contact
with contaminated surfaces, where the virus can remain viable for hours to
days. The development of rapid diagnostic tests, such as PCR and antigen tests,
has played a crucial role in identifying and isolating infected individuals,
helping to curb the virus's spread.
One of the
most significant challenges in managing COVID-19 is its ability to mutate and
give rise to new variants. These genetic changes can affect the virus's
transmissibility, severity, and vaccine efficacy. Variants of concern, such as
the Delta and Omicron variants, have raised concerns about increased
transmissibility and vaccine resistance. Scientists closely monitor these variants
and adapt vaccines and treatments as needed to combat the evolving virus.
Vaccines
have been a key scientific achievement in the fight against COVID-19. Multiple
vaccines, including mRNA-based vaccines and viral vector vaccines, have been
developed and deployed globally. These vaccines teach the immune system to
recognize and fight the virus, reducing the severity of the disease and
preventing hospitalization and death. Vaccination campaigns are a testament to
the collaborative efforts of scientists, pharmaceutical companies, and public
health institutions in developing and distributing vaccines on an unprecedented
scale.
Antiviral
treatments and therapies, such as monoclonal antibodies and antiviral drugs
like remdesivir, have been developed to mitigate the severity of COVID-19 in
those who become infected. Scientific research and clinical trials continue to
explore new treatments and therapies to improve patient outcomes.

Global Response to COVID-19:
The global response to COVID-19 represents an unprecedented collaborative effort among nations, public health organizations, and the scientific community to combat a common threat. As COVID-19 rapidly spread across borders, governments and international institutions took a range of measures to contain the virus. These measures included travel restrictions, lockdowns, and quarantine protocols. While these actions aimed to reduce transmission, they also carried significant economic and social consequences, underscoring the need for a delicate balance between public health and societal well-being.
International
cooperation and information sharing played a crucial role in the response to
COVID-19. The World Health Organization (WHO) and other global health bodies
facilitated the exchange of data, research, and best practices among nations.
Researchers and scientists worldwide collaborated to study the virus,
understand its transmission, and develop diagnostic tests, treatments, and
vaccines at an unprecedented pace. The swift development and distribution of
vaccines, often through international partnerships, exemplify the importance of
global solidarity in confronting the pandemic.
Challenges
in vaccine distribution and equitable access highlighted the need for a
coordinated global response. The disparities in vaccine distribution between
high-income and low-income countries have brought attention to issues of global
health equity. Initiatives such as COVAX, designed to ensure equitable access
to vaccines, underscore the shared responsibility of the international community
in addressing the pandemic.

Social and Economic Consequences of COVID-19:
The COVID-19
pandemic has unleashed profound social and economic consequences, challenging
the resilience of individuals and societies worldwide. Economic repercussions
were swift and severe, with the pandemic causing widespread job losses,
business closures, and economic turmoil. Lockdowns and travel restrictions,
although necessary to control the virus's spread, disrupted global supply
chains, leading to reduced production and increased unemployment rates. Many
businesses, particularly in the hospitality, travel, and entertainment sectors,
suffered significant losses, highlighting the pandemic's unequal economic
impact.
The pandemic
also forced a seismic shift in the world of work and education. Remote work and
online learning became the new norm for many, challenging individuals and
institutions to adapt to virtual environments. This shift had both positive and
negative consequences, as it provided flexibility but also increased feelings
of isolation and blurred the boundaries between work and personal life.
The mental
health and well-being of individuals globally have been profoundly affected by
the pandemic. The anxiety and uncertainty surrounding the virus, coupled with
social isolation and disruption of daily routines, took a toll on mental
health. The pandemic spotlighted the importance of mental health services and
support networks and emphasized the need for destigmatization and increased
access to mental health resources.
The pandemic
also revealed stark disparities in healthcare systems and access to healthcare
services. Vulnerable and marginalized populations faced greater challenges
during the pandemic, as existing healthcare disparities were exacerbated.
Communities with limited access to healthcare facilities, people with
preexisting health conditions, and individuals in congregate settings, such as
nursing homes and correctional facilities, faced higher infection rates and
worse outcomes.

Healthcare and Medical Responses to COVID-19:
The
healthcare and medical responses to COVID-19 have been at the forefront of the
battle against the pandemic. Hospitals and healthcare systems around the world
faced unprecedented challenges, from managing surges in patients to ensuring
the safety of healthcare workers.
One of the
most significant challenges has been ensuring adequate hospital capacity. In
the early stages of the pandemic, hospitals faced the daunting task of
accommodating a sudden influx of COVID-19 patients. In many places, medical
facilities were stretched to their limits, leading to concerns about
overwhelmed healthcare systems. Hospitals implemented various strategies, such
as creating temporary field hospitals and converting non-medical facilities
into treatment centers, to manage the surge in patients.
Testing and
contact tracing became essential components of the healthcare response.
Widespread testing allowed for the identification of infected individuals,
enabling prompt isolation and treatment. Contact tracing helped break chains of
transmission by identifying and notifying those who had been in close contact
with infected individuals. These measures were crucial in curbing the spread of
the virus, particularly in the absence of a vaccine in the early stages of the
pandemic.
Frontline
healthcare workers emerged as heroes in the battle against COVID-19. Doctors,
nurses, and other medical professionals worked tirelessly to care for patients,
often at great personal risk. The dedication and sacrifice of these individuals
were widely acknowledged and celebrated. Healthcare systems also had to adapt
rapidly to provide the necessary protective equipment and support for their
staff.
Telemedicine
and remote care saw a significant expansion in response to the pandemic. With
social distancing measures in place and concerns about in-person healthcare
visits, virtual consultations and telehealth services became a vital means of
providing medical care. This shift in healthcare delivery not only enabled
continued access to care but also highlighted the potential for future
innovations in healthcare services.

Social Dynamics and Behavior during COVID-19:
The COVID-19
pandemic has not only been a public health crisis but also a test of societies'
collective behavior and response. Social dynamics and human behavior have
played a pivotal role in the transmission and containment of the virus.
Public
health messaging became a critical tool in shaping individual and collective
behavior. Governments, health organizations, and experts worldwide sought to
educate the public about the virus's seriousness and the importance of
preventive measures. The efficacy of these messages varied, with factors such
as clarity, consistency, and trust in authorities influencing the public's
adherence to recommended behaviors, such as mask-wearing, hand hygiene, and
social distancing.
Misinformation
and the spread of conspiracy theories posed significant challenges during the
pandemic. The digital age allowed misinformation to circulate rapidly,
undermining public trust in official guidance and public health measures.
Debunking myths and combating misinformation became a central concern in
managing the pandemic, highlighting the importance of media literacy and
reliable sources of information.
Social
distancing and mask mandates were among the key public health measures designed
to reduce virus transmission. The implementation of these measures was met with
mixed compliance, reflecting differing cultural, political, and socioeconomic
factors. Social dynamics played a significant role in people's adherence to
these measures, and the pandemic exposed societal divisions over issues of
personal freedom, risk perception, and public health responsibility.
Vaccine
hesitancy emerged as a challenge to achieving widespread immunity. Concerns
about vaccine safety, mistrust in pharmaceutical companies, and misinformation
all contributed to vaccine hesitancy. Social networks and influencers played a
role in shaping public attitudes toward vaccination. Vaccination campaigns
included efforts to address these concerns, promote vaccine confidence, and
reach underserved communities.

Vulnerable Populations during COVID-19:
The COVID-19
pandemic has had a disproportionate impact on vulnerable populations,
highlighting and exacerbating existing inequalities in access to healthcare and
social determinants of health. Various groups, including the elderly, those
with preexisting health conditions, low-income communities, and marginalized
populations, have faced unique challenges during the pandemic.
The elderly,
particularly those living in long-term care facilities, have been one of the
most vulnerable groups to the virus. Advanced age is a significant risk factor
for severe illness and mortality from COVID-19. Congregate living settings like
nursing homes and assisted living facilities have been hotspots for outbreaks,
as the virus spread rapidly among residents. The pandemic raised critical
questions about long-term care and the need for improved infection control
measures and staff support.
People with
preexisting health conditions, such as heart disease, diabetes, and respiratory
diseases, have faced increased risks from COVID-19. These individuals often
experience more severe illness when infected. Disparities in healthcare access
and quality of care have exacerbated these risks, as those with chronic
conditions may have limited resources or face difficulties in managing their health
during the pandemic.
Low-income communities and essential workers have borne the brunt of economic and health disparities during the pandemic. Many essential workers, such as grocery store employees, healthcare workers, and delivery personnel, faced higher risks of exposure to the virus due to their continued work. Low-income communities often have limited access to healthcare and may live in crowded conditions, making it challenging to practice social distancing and isolate when needed.
Lessons Learned and Future Preparedness in the Wake of
COVID-19:
The COVID-19
pandemic has provided valuable lessons and insights for the global community,
underscoring the need for enhanced preparedness to confront future health
crises effectively. As we navigate the ongoing challenges of the pandemic, we
must also consider how to better equip ourselves for future threats to global
health.
One of the
primary lessons learned is the importance of early and transparent
communication. The pandemic exposed the consequences of delayed information
sharing and the dissemination of inaccurate information. Global health
organizations and governments must prioritize transparent and timely
communication to provide clear guidance, build trust, and ensure a coordinated
global response.
The pandemic
has highlighted the critical role of scientific research and international
collaboration. Rapid vaccine development and the sharing of research data
exemplify the power of global scientific cooperation. Future preparedness
efforts must focus on fostering international partnerships, streamlining
research processes, and ensuring equitable access to scientific advancements.
Another key
lesson is the need for resilient and adaptable healthcare systems. The strain
placed on healthcare systems by the pandemic underscored the importance of
surge capacity, flexible infrastructure, and adequate medical supplies.
Preparing for future health crises requires investments in healthcare
infrastructure, a robust supply chain, and surge capacity planning.
Public
health preparedness is equally vital. The pandemic exposed gaps in preparedness
and response plans at the national and international levels. Investments in
disease surveillance, contact tracing, and pandemic response strategies are
essential to mitigate the impact of future health crises and enable swift,
effective containment.
Global
health equity is a central theme in the lessons learned from COVID-19. The
pandemic unveiled stark disparities in access to healthcare and resources,
disproportionately affecting marginalized communities. Future preparedness must
prioritize equitable access to healthcare, ensuring that vulnerable populations
are not left behind.
